Burna Boy achieves a new African milestone by securing the highest-grossing venue record in the United States.


 In another remarkable accomplishment, Burna Boy emerges as the African artist with the highest-grossing venue in the United States. According to a post by Touring Data on X, Burna Boy's 2024 concert at the TD Garden Arena in Boston generated $1.593 million in revenue, surpassing his previous African record set at Madison Square Garden in 2022.

During his groundbreaking concert, Burna Boy filled all 19,000 seats at the TD Arena Garden in Boston as part of his 'I Told Them' Tour, which has already amassed $11,659,531 from 11 reported shows out of its 22 stops.

Burna Boy's groundbreaking achievement underscores his position as the foremost African artist on the global stage. Since his breakout onto the international scene in 2018 with the smash hit 'YE', Burna Boy has attained unprecedented success for an African artist. Affectionately known as the African Giant, he holds the distinction of being the sole Nigerian artist with two Diamond-certified songs in France: 'On The Low' and 'Last Last'. Additionally, his Grammy-nominated fourth album, 'African Giant', is the first Nigerian album to receive a platinum certification in France. With 10 Grammy nominations, Burna Boy holds the record for the most Grammy nominations by a Nigerian artist. He further made history in February 2024 at the 66th Grammys as the first African artist to perform at the main ceremony.
